Qualified loan definition

Qualified loan means a loan made under this act or former 1961 PA 108 from this state to a school district to pay debt service on a qualified bond.
Qualified loan means a loan or a portion of a loan made by a Participating Financial Institution to a Qualified Business for any business activity that has its Primary economic effect in California. A Qualified Loan may be made in the form of a line of credit, in which case the Participating Financial Institution shall specify the amount of the line of credit to be covered under the Program, which may be equal to the maximum commitment under the line of credit or an amount that is less than the maximum commitment.
